Output 64479cc4a91495d00bb155d0c053b39c5f6ccecdd56a7b51f47803c81248caf7:2

value
49667
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 56eeee1a257391f308c100575eae04e14fab38ea6bee72e27ba9bb2256ba3f8d
address
tb1p2mhwux39wwglxzxpqpt4atsyu986kw82d0h89cnm4xajy44687xsvqah9f
transaction
64479cc4a91495d00bb155d0c053b39c5f6ccecdd56a7b51f47803c81248caf7
confirmations
51513
spent
true